ZIP code 60501 is a mid-sized community (a standard USPS delivery area) in Summit Argo, Cook County, Illinois, home to 11,626 residents across 12.5 square miles, a density of 928 people per square mile, in the Chicago time zone.
ZIP 60501 reports a modest median household income of $63,244 (21% below the Illinois average), while per-capita income is $33,970. Local economic indicators show a 11.5% poverty rate alongside 5.5% unemployment. On housing, the median home value is $234,300 (22% above the state average) with median rent at $1,142 per month, and 62.2% of occupied units are owner-occupied.
Formal educational attainment runs low here: just 14.6%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 38.2, and the average commute is 29 minutes. Home values in ZIP 60501 have decreased 1.3% over the past year (2024). Since 2000, this ZIP has seen +106% cumulative appreciation.
| Year | Annual Change | HPI Index |
|---|---|---|
| 2020 | -2.9% | 162 |
| 2021 | +7.9% | 175 |
| 2022 | +14.8% | 201 |
| 2023 | +3.6% | 208 |
| 2024 | -1.3% | 206 |
Source: Federal Housing Finance Agency (FHFA) House Price Index, All-Transactions, Five-Digit ZIP Codes (Developmental Index). Index base = 100 in year 2000. Data through 2024. ZIP codes with few transactions may show missing values.

Census Bureau data shows 247 business establishments in ZIP 60501, employing approximately 4,212 people with a combined annual payroll of $287,288,000.
